Diagnostic Imaging Equipment Market Segmentation and Market Companies
Segments
- Based on product type, the market can be segmented into MRI systems, ultrasound systems, CT scanners, X-ray equipment, nuclear imaging, and others. MRI systems are expected to witness significant growth due to their high resolution and non-invasive nature, making them ideal for diagnosing various medical conditions. Ultrasound systems are versatile and widely used across different medical specialties. CT scanners are known for their detailed cross-sectional imaging capabilities. X-ray equipment remains a staple in medical imaging for its cost-effectiveness and efficiency. Nuclear imaging techniques are valuable for diagnosing certain diseases through the use of radioactive tracers.
- On the basis of end-users, the market is segmented into hospitals, diagnostic imaging centers, and others. Hospitals account for a significant share of the market due to the high volume of imaging procedures conducted in these settings. Diagnostic imaging centers are dedicated facilities that specialize in providing various imaging services to patients. Other end-users include ambulatory surgical centers, research institutes, and others.
- Geographically, the market is segmented into North America, Europe, Asia-Pacific, Latin America, and the Middle East & Africa. North America dominates the market due to the presence of advanced healthcare infrastructure, high healthcare expenditure, and technological advancements in diagnostic imaging equipment. Europe follows suit with increasing adoption of innovative imaging technologies. The Asia-Pacific region is expected to witness rapid growth driven by improving healthcare facilities, rising prevalence of chronic diseases, and increasing investments in the healthcare sector.
